Ubisoft has just revealed the follow-up to its 2011 guitar/band sim, Rocksmith 2014.

The publisher called it "the fastest way to learn guitar".
Ubi held off announcing a platform, although it seems safe to assume a multi platform release and - on Xbox platforms - Kinect support.
